Understanding the Objectives

The first step in creating a successful BTEC Business Level 3 Marketing Campaign is to clearly define your objectives. Objectives should be specific, measurable, achievable, relevant, and time-bound (SMART). They should reflect what you want to achieve with the campaign. Examples of objectives include increasing sales, generating leads, increasing brand awareness, and improving customer engagement.

Know Your Audience

Knowing your target audience is essential in creating a successful BTEC Business Level 3 Marketing Campaign. The more you know about your audience, the better you can tailor your message and marketing strategy to their needs and preferences. Use demographics such as age, gender, income, education level, and lifestyle to create buyer personas that will guide your marketing efforts.

Create a Unique Value Proposition

A Unique Value Proposition (UVP) is a statement that explains why your product, service, or brand is unique and better than your competitors. Your UVP should be clear and concise, and it should resonate with your target audience. It should be integrated into all aspects of your marketing campaign, including your messaging, branding, and visuals.

Choose the Right Channels

Choosing the right channels to reach your target audience is crucial in creating a successful BTEC Business Level 3 Marketing Campaign. The channels you choose will depend on the demographics and preferences of your target audience. Popular channels include social media, email marketing, content marketing, search engine marketing, and event marketing.

Create Compelling Content

Compelling content is content that engages, informs, and persuades your audience to take action. Your content should be relevant, useful, and authoritative. It should also be optimized for search engines to increase its visibility and reach. Use a mix of different content formats such as blog posts, videos, infographics, and whitepapers to appeal to different learning styles and preferences.

Measure and Evaluate

Measuring and evaluating the success of your BTEC Business Level 3 Marketing Campaign is essential in identifying the areas that require improvement and the strategies that work. Use metrics such as website traffic, conversion rates, engagement rates, and ROI to track the performance of your campaign. Use the insights you gather to refine your strategy and improve your results.
